Issue Details: First known date: 2004... 2004 Authors Take Sides : Iraq and the Gulf War

AbstractHistoryArchive Description

'Based on writers' responses to a questionnaire, this book records contemporary opinions and reactions to two of the most contentious issues of our times, the Gulf War of 1991 and the Iraq invasion of 2003.'More than 170 distinguished authors (including 19 Australians) - novelists, playwrights, journalists, biographers, poets and historians - have contributed to this book.' From http://www.mup.unimelb.edu.au/catalogue/0-522-85136-3.html (Sighted 5/07/04)
